Innocent Hearts Group of Institutions Hosts Inter-Department Debate Competition The Literary Club at Innocent Hearts Group of Institutions successfully organized an engaging Inter-Department Debate Competition at Horizon Hall. The event was designed to provide students with a dynamic platform to express their views, develop critical thinking, and enhance their confidence in public speaking. Sixteen energetic teams from the departments of Management, Information Technology, Hotel Management, and Medical Sciences participated, presenting well-researched arguments on contemporary and thought-provoking topics such as whether social media does more harm than good to mental health, whether soft skills outweigh technical skills in the 21st century, and whether machines can be held accountable for ethics in the age of AI.
